Circle the common factors of 18W and 30WZ

6,6w,6xz,3z



3w,z,10w, w

Answer:

6, 6w, 3w, z and w.

Explanation:

The common factors are those values that can divide 18w and 30wz perfectly.

Take a look at 6, 6 can divide both perfectly to give 3w and 5wz respectively.

We move on to 6w, this can also work perfectly to yield 3 and 5z.

6xz is not a factor as both values do not contain any x term.

3z is not a factor. Although 30wz has a z term, 18w does not.

3w is a factor as it can give 10z and 6 when used to divide the terms.

Z is not a factor as the 18w term does not contain a z term.

10w is not a term as it can not divide 18w perfectly

w is a term as it can divide both 18w and 30wz perfectly to yield 18 and 30z respectively.
